Chargers vs. Cardinals 2013: How to watch online, TV schedule, radio and more

Arizona is hoping Carson Palmer can deliver the consistency that has defined the Philip Rivers era in San Diego.

When the San Diego Chargers and Arizona Cardinals face off in Saturday's preseason matchup, the tales of two very different quarterback situations will clash in University of Phoenix Stadium. Philip Rivers has been rock-steady for the Chargers since taking over the starting job in 2006, racking up four Pro Bowls and emerging as one of the league's premier quarterbacks in that span. The Cardinals, on the other hand, will be hoping that the recently-acquired Carson Palmer can return consistency to a position that has wildly inconsistent since the departure of Kurt Warner in 2010.

The Chargers have lost both of their first two preseason games, losing to the Seattle Seahawks 31-10 in Week 1 before coming up short against the Chicago Bears in a 33-28 defeat. The Cardinals, meanwhile, are undefeated in preseason play. They blanked the Green Bay Packers 17-0 two weeks ago, then dropped the Dallas Cowboys 12-7 in Week 2.
